🌼 Growing Information
Common Name: Silver Squill
Botanical Name: Ledebouria socialis
Other Name: Leopard Lily
Plant Type: Bulbous succulent perennial
Growth Stage: Live plant
Foliage: Silver-green leaves with dark green spots
Sun Requirements: Bright indirect light to partial sun
Soil: Fast-draining cactus, succulent, or bulb mix
Watering: Allow soil to dry between waterings; avoid overwatering
Growth Habit: Compact and clumping
Temperature: Prefers warm conditions; protect from frost
Container Friendly: Yes
Best For: Indoor collections, windowsills, succulent gardens, containers, rock gardens, and plant displays
💡 Care Tip: Plant your Silver Squill in a fast-draining soil mix and provide bright light. Allow the soil to dry between waterings, especially during cooler periods. Avoid keeping the soil constantly wet, as excessive moisture can cause bulb and root problems. Protect outdoor plants from frost and prolonged cold temperatures.
